Can anyone set me straight on Chinese RVSM? No, I'm not supposed to be flying through it anytime soon, I'm just doing some research.
Here is what I've managed to piece together:
-Begins at 8900 meters and extends to 12500 meters.
-Separation is 1000 feet but assigned in 300 meter increments
-When assigned a metric flight level in Chinese RVSM you use your conversion chart determine the flight level in feet then "add 100 feet" to determine what altitude to maintain
-The 100 feet are added to ensure 1000 feet of separation
-You must use a foot-calibrated altimeter while in Chinese RVSM
Is any of this information inaccurate? Is there anything else in particular I should know about Chinese RVSM if I was going to be asked some general questions about it? Any information is appreciated!
